Silicon Power 600x (16GB) |
2010-05-12 |
| |
 |
Silicon Power offers 600x CompactFlash Type I cards at capacities of 8, 16, and 32GB. We received the 16GB model, which mopped up the competition in our benchmark runs. Silicon Power's 91.6 MB/s interface performance is an all-time high result. The card doesn’t deliver maximum performance on sequential writes though, scoring between 50 and 82.4 MB/s. However, the read performance was really stunning. This was the only product to pass the 90 MB/s mark. A 91 MB/s minimum and 91.6 MB/s maximum speak loud and clear. Read performance was very fast and consistent, allowing copying of data from the card to a computer at the highest possible speed... |

Silicon Power Luxmini 320 8 GB |
2010-05-12 |
| |
 |
Taiwan-based Silicon Power is a rising name in the storage media business and they manufacture a wide array of storage devices. PC memory, memory cards, USB Flash storage, portable hard drives, SSDs - you name it and Silicon Power manufactures it. Amongst their USB Flash drives, they have some products that are manufactured from a very practical point of view and are meant to give the consumer a good value for their money. The Silicon Power Luxmini 320 8GB drive we received is a simple and elegant USB Flash drive. Let us find out how it performs.
The Luxmini 320 drive comes attractively packed in a transparent plastic enclosure. The flash drive comes with no bundle. If Silicon Power would have provided a USB extension cable, it would have allowed you to plug it into a rear USB port without the need to reach to the back of your PC. Also, a lanyard would have made it easier to keep track of the drive... |
